This is Pier 60.  Looking off the edge of this there were TONS of sting rays. Like seriously everywhere.  Apparently it's breeding season there since the water is so warm they just come and hang out in the shallows. They tell you to do the "stingray shuffle" to scare them away.  Totally works.

Waiting for our boat to Caladesi Island.  Hands down our favorite place.  We made sure to take the first boat out there (it's an uninhabited private island) and we were the first people on the beach.  Literally alone on miles of white sandy beaches.
